Why this Edition is Special? Known as one of the quintessential American poets, Whitman is nothing if not a poet of broad scope. His poems seek to capture a diversity of experiences and revel in the multiplicities and contradictions of life. Though Whitman celebrated America in his verse, he also wrote about living through America's Civil War, an experience he would recount with anger, fear, and empathy.This special edition have a rare fictionalised account of the day-to-day life of Walt Whitman, written by Mary Byron. A fascinating and insight biographical work of the great American poet, this is a book that will greatly appeal to fans of Walt Whitman.
